"A tranquil Two-Key Michelin, high-end ryokan of unrivaled luxury, with 15 private villas—each boasting indoor and outdoor onsens—and a free shuttle to the slopes or town." - Brent Rose

"As a modern ryokan, it embraces updated or even radical design, architecture, and luxuries while still drawing its appeal from onsen baths, kaiseki dinners, and a connection with the countryside." - The MICHELIN Guide

"Tucked into a birch forest near Niseko, Zaborin redefines the ryokan: discreet luxury across 15 villas each with private indoor and open-air onsens fed by natural springs, quietly exquisite design (clean lines, washi lighting, panoramic forest views), and a multi-course dinner that blends kaiseki artistry with seasonal storytelling." - Jonnie Bayfield

"Communal onsen, or hot springs, are a hallmark of Japanese culture, but at Zaborin your plunging in the hot volcanic spring water can be done in the privacy of your serene forest-facing villas; each of the only 15 rooms comes equipped with its own indoor and outdoor private baths. When you’re not lingering in the waters, linger over a robatayaki omakase meal." - Fiorella Valdesolo

"A luxury ryokan about 15 minutes from Niseko, notable for its design-forward approach and private hot springs, offering a tranquil, refined alternative to busier slope-side hotels." - Jessica Chapel
